Bio:

The name Mark Baker may not be immediately recognizable to many, but for liner note/album credits junkies, it signifies top shelf AOR songwriting. Whether it be anthems or ballads, a Mark Baker song means memorable hooks and a big chorus. Mark Baker is the man behind the iconic Signal "Loud & Clear" album as well as many other songs including tracks for .38 Special, Paris Black, Triumph and Boulevard. He was also the main co-writer on House Of Lords' acclaimed "Demons Down" record, rejoining as co-writer on some of the band's more recent albums too."The Future Ain't What It Used To Be" is a compilation of Mark's songwriter demos from the 80s and 90s. The songwriter demos feature various singers, including the best session vocalist of them all: Mark Free. I'm pleased to say there are several unreleased Mark Free vocals. But that's not all. There are some original demos from the House Of Lords "Demons Down" record as well as an appearance from Chicago's Bill Champlin on an amazing AOR anthem. Several of these demos have been traded online for years and MRR is thrilled to bring one disc of this material to light in July. The tracks come from DAT masters and will as always be remastered by JK Northrup.

Album:

The name Mark Baker may not be immediately recognizable to many, but he is the man behind the classic Signal ‘Loud & Clear’ album as well as many other songs for the likes of .38 Special, Triumph and Boulevard. He was also the main co-writer on House Of Lords’ ‘Demons Down’ album.Two years ago, MelodicRock Records gave songwriter Mark Baker a chance to compile some of his best songwriter demos onto a release under his own name for the first time.Now under the new label name MelodicRock Classics, its time to deliver another Volume of tracks, with a couple of limited edition options giving fans the chance to own the entire collection of Mark Baker melodic rock demos.Sharing a similar name, the new release 'The Future Still Ain't What It Used To Be' pays homage to the first album, sharing the epic title track 'The Future Ain't What It Used To Be' over both releases.However, on the new release, the song is sung by the great Caryl Mack Parker.The rest of the album consists of fresh unreleased material, but some of the songs may still sound familiar.The album contains an amazing original Signal demo for the Van Stephenson/Mark Baker co-write Wake Up You Little Fool; also a David Roberts sung demo of the Boulevard track In The Twilight; An Aina sung version of the James Christian track 'No Pleasure Without Pain' and more.
